            <description><![CDATA[ you want it probably as<br />
$PHORUM['user_custom_fields_table'] = 'dxb_user_custom_fields';<br />
if thats the already existing user table.<br />
And yes, the quotes are needed.<br />
<br />
You will have to install the new phorum first completely and after installation (with the different prefix) change the mysql.php of the new install to use the old prefix for the two user tables, not only the custom fields table.]]></description>

            <description><![CDATA[ <blockquote class="bbcode"><div><small>Quote<br/></small><strong>seventhc</strong><br/>
Do you mean create a new directory like &quot;my_templates&quot; and put it in there or make a copy of the changed template &quot;emerald&quot; and name it something like &quot;my_emerald&quot; but staying in the default template directory.</div></blockquote>
<br />
You can rename the directory /emerald/ to something like /seventhc/ and then edit info.php to reflect the name change.<br />
<br />
Then if you upgrade, a new emerald directory will get created, but /seventhc/ will remain unscathed, and your forum defaults will still be linked to /seventhc/<br />
<br />
My templates are SO hacked and personalized, and this is how upgrades don't break my site or undo my customizations.]]></description>
